Changing the Screen Aspect Ratio

The TV can display images in five different modes: Zoom1, Zoom2, Normal, Automatic and Panoramic. Each mode displays the picture differently.

To change the screen aspect ratio:

1.Press the MENU button on the remote.

2.Use the Arrow buttons to highlight the Wide icon. Press OK.

3.Use the Arrow buttons to highlight your desired screen mode and press OK.
